I am working on an After Effects file, and a few days ago it sent me this error:
"chunk in file is too big - probably unsupported file version. (33::7)"
Plus it changes the name of mt file from "scene_01" to "scene_01.6612.10392" on its own...
I can't open the AE file in any of the computers I've tried it on (I tried 3), and I can't import the file into a new AE file, it doesn't read any of my files. I couldn't find any older versions, and couldn't find any autosaves, for some reason I don't even have an autosave folder.
In case it makes any difference, I was working on an external device. Of course I saved everything an ejected it properly.
And in case you were wondering, I was working on the 2020 AE version, so I'm not sure what is the matter with the version part. Tried to update it to the latest one, didn't help.
